Alex Dunne handed FP1 outing with McLaren in Austria

© XPB  Phillip van Osten 23/06/2025 at 15:0823/06/2025 at 14:10 McLaren junior driver and current Formula 2 championship leader Alex Dunne will take a major step in his motorsport journey next weekend when he makes his official Formula 1 debut during Friday’s first free practice at the Austrian Grand Prix. The 18-year-old Irishman will take over Lando Norris’ McLaren for the session at the Red Bull Ring, as part of the team’s rookie driver allocation for the 2025 season. Dunne’s FP1 debut comes on the back of a rapid ascent through the junior ranks and a breakout campaign in his first full F2 season with Rodin Motorsport, where he currently leads the standings....
